Output e591c0e5c86e368c4a4b96304486b36c3ef740d22c63c99eac1b3584bd8459f1:0

value
2790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e076ea8049594686f45c5e32b76582a4defab5fd OP_EQUAL
address
3N9sjwgpNtGVrKTnyNzCBCcoWHqLNEPkNP
transaction
e591c0e5c86e368c4a4b96304486b36c3ef740d22c63c99eac1b3584bd8459f1
spent
true